Seems like every day, the unraid UI just bugs out, and stops working. The only way to recover is to reboot the system, and for some reason, unraid detects a dirty shutdown and demands a full parity check. I've been on unraid for 8 days now, haven't purchased a license yet, still on trial.

 

Here's some of the logs that seem to be causing the issue, seems to be an issue with the USB:

You've either got a bad flash drive or a bad port.   The flash dropped offline (the directory bread errors)   the call trace happened when linux was trying to mark the file system of the flash as being dirty (ie not ejected properly)  this is also why it wants to do a check every time you boot as it can't write to the flash to signify the shutdown was clean

Be sure that you use a USB2 port for the Flash Drive.  (The extra speed of a USB3 port is not required for unRAID as the OS is installed on a RAM disk and it runs from there.  The USB is only normally only accessed during boot and shutdown.)  USB3 ports have given problems in the past to folks.  Not everyone has an issue with them and It seems to be with certain MB and BIOS versions.
